Examples of SampleClientResult


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testDualQuote() {
        String addUrl = "http://localhost:9000/services/SimpleStockQuoteService";
        String trpUrl = "http://localhost:8280/";

        log.info("Running test: Dual channel invocation through Synapse");
        SampleClientResult result = client.requestDualQuote(addUrl, trpUrl, null, "IBM");
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testErrorHandling() {
        String addUrl = "http://localhost:9000/services/SimpleStockQuoteService";
        String trpUrl = "http://localhost:8280";

        log.info("Running test: Introduction to error handling");
        SampleClientResult result = client.requestStandardQuote(addUrl, trpUrl, null, "IBM" ,null);
        assertResponseReceived(result);

        result = client.requestStandardQuote(addUrl, trpUrl, null, "MSFT" ,null);
        assertFalse("Must not get a response", result.responseReceived());
        Exception resultEx = result.getException();
        assertNotNull("Did not receive expected error" , resultEx);
        log.info("Got an error as expected: " + resultEx.getMessage());
        assertTrue("Did not receive expected error", resultEx instanceof AxisFault);

        result = client.requestStandardQuote(addUrl, trpUrl, null, "SUN" ,null);
        assertFalse("Must not get a response", result.responseReceived());
        Exception resultEx2 = result.getException();
        assertNotNull("Did not receive expected error" , resultEx);
        log.info("Got an error as expected: " + resultEx.getMessage());
        assertTrue("Did not receive expected error", resultEx2 instanceof AxisFault);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testDumbClientMode() {
        String trpUrl = "http://localhost:8280/services/StockQuote";

        log.info("Running test: Dumb Client mode");
        SampleClientResult result = client.requestStandardQuote(null, trpUrl, null, "IBM" ,null);
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testSessionLessLB() {
        String addUrl = "http://localhost:8280/services/LBService1";

        log.info("Running test: Session-less load balancing between 3 endpoints");
        SampleClientResult result = client.sessionlessClient(addUrl, null, 100);
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testSmartClientMode() {
        String addUrl = "http://localhost:8280";

        log.info("Running test: Smart Client mode");
        SampleClientResult result = client.requestStandardQuote(addUrl, null, null, "IBM" ,null);
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testRegistryAndXSLTMediator() {
        String addUrl = "http://localhost:9000/services/SimpleStockQuoteService";
        String trpUrl = "http://localhost:8280/";

        log.info("Running test: Introduction to static and dynamic registry resources, and using XSLT transformations  ");
        SampleClientResult result = client.requestCustomQuote(addUrl, trpUrl, null, "IBM");
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ult


    public void testSessionFullLB() {
        String addUrl = "http://localhost:8280/services/LBService1";
        log.info("Running test: Session affinity load balancing between 3 endpoints");
        SampleClientResult result = client.statefulClient(addUrl,null, 100);
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

    public void testCBR() {
        String addUrl = "http://localhost:9000/services/SimpleStockQuoteService";
        String trpUrl = "http://localhost:8280";

        log.info("Running test: CBR with the Switch-case mediator, using message properties");
        SampleClientResult result = client.requestStandardQuote(addUrl, trpUrl, null, "IBM" ,null);
        assertResponseReceived(result);
        result = client.requestStandardQuote(addUrl, trpUrl, null, "MSFT" ,null);
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

        String ep = "http://localhost:8280/services/MTOMSwASampleService";
        String currentLocation = System.getProperty("user.dir") + File.separator;
        String filename = FilenameUtils.normalize(
                currentLocation + "repository/conf/sample/resources/mtom/asf-logo.gif");
        log.info("Running test: MTOM optimization and request/response correlation ");
        SampleClientResult result = client.sendUsingMTOM(filename, ep);
        assertResponseReceived(result);
    }
View Full Code Here

Examples of org.apache.synapse.samples.framework.SampleClientResult

        String currentLocation = System.getProperty("user.dir") + File.separator;
        String filename = FilenameUtils.normalize(
                currentLocation + "repository/conf/sample/resources/mtom/asf-logo.gif");

        log.info("Running test:SwA optimization and request/response correlation ");
        SampleClientResult result = client.sendUsingSWA(filename, ep);
        assertResponseReceived(result);
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.